Automotive OEMs and parts manufacturers are under increasing pressure to improve ESG and sustainability performance – from internal leadership and employees to external stakeholders. such as investors, creditors, policy makers, supply chain partners, and consumers. This presents many challenges depending on your internal competencies and knowledge of material reporting topics and KPIs for the automotive industry.

First, it is important to understand what ESG and sustainability is (and is not), where it came from, and why it is only going to grow as an expectation in the future.

Second, it is crucial to understand your own unique business drivers and challenges, so you can navigate the complexity of ESG and sustainability frameworks, standards, and rating agencies to focus on what truly matters.

And finally, you can identify and prioritize material topics, KPIs, and performance expectations of key stakeholders in the automotive industry.
